Output 379043865c2078e0b9ee6cedc34f82a92a2f1dbe8434c90ed71fc7801d321455:1

value
42435856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e6266c3c4310596680a23f2c4ed577e205de87 OP_EQUAL
address
MVmdSPMPYKBXusnVnnNAv4fr3812sgZHLS
transaction
379043865c2078e0b9ee6cedc34f82a92a2f1dbe8434c90ed71fc7801d321455
spent
true